﻿*{margin:0;padding:0;}
body 
{   
    margin:0;
    padding:0;
	font-family:"微软雅黑"; 
	/*font-size:14px;*/ 
	 cursor: default;
	 background-color:#eee;

	 
	
}
html{font-size:625%}
.hide{display: none}
table{border-collapse:collapse;border-spacing:0px;}
a{text-decoration:none;font-size:14px;outline:none;}
/* a:hover{text-decoration:underline} */
a:active{outline:none;}
a img{border:0;}
.clearfix{clear:both}
 body,div,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6,form,input,textarea,b{padding:0;margin:0}
a:focus,input,select,textarea{outline:0}

textarea{resize:none;overflow:auto}
ul,ol,li{list-style-type:none;}
h1,h2,h3,h4,h5,h6{font-weight:normal}
.l{float: left !important}
.r{float: right !important;}


.clear{clear: both; height: 0;}

  @media only screen and (min-width: 320px){
    html {
    font-size: 625% !important;
   }
 }
  @media only screen and (min-width: 375px){
    html {
    font-size: 721% !important;
   }
 }
   @media only screen and (min-width: 414px){
    html {
    /*font-size: 796% !important;*/
	font-size: 776% !important;
   }
 }
/*  @media only screen and (min-width: 481px){
    html {
    font-size: 925% !important;
   }
 }
  @media only screen and (min-width: 561px){
   html {
    font-size: 1079% !important;
  }
 }
 
 @media only screen and (min-width: 640px){
   html {
    font-size: 1230% !important;
  }
 }
 */

 @font-face {
  font-family: 'icomoon';
  src:  url('fonts/icomoon.eot?2smjpj');
  src:  url('fonts/icomoon.eot?2smjpj#iefix') format('embedded-opentype'),
    url('fonts/icomoon.ttf?2smjpj') format('truetype'),
    url('fonts/icomoon.woff?2smjpj') format('woff'),
    url('fonts/icomoon.svg?2smjpj#icomoon') format('svg');
  font-weight: normal;
  font-style: normal;
  font-display: block;
}

[class^="icon-"], [class*=" icon-"] {
  /* use !important to prevent issues with browser extensions that change fonts */
  font-family: 'icomoon' !important;
  font-style: normal;
  font-weight: normal;
  font-variant: normal;
  text-transform: none;
  line-height: 1;

  /* Better Font Rendering =========== */
  -webkit-font-smoothing: antialiased;
  -moz-osx-font-smoothing: grayscale;
}

.icon-1-01:before {
  content: "\e900";
  color: #e52a30;
}
.icon-1-02:before {
  content: "\e901";
}
.icon-1-03:before {
  content: "\e902";
}
.icon-1-04:before {
  content: "\e903";
}
.icon-1-05:before {
  content: "\e904";
}
.icon-1-06:before {
  content: "\e905";
}
.icon-1-07:before {
  content: "\e906";
}
.icon-1-08:before {
  content: "\e907";
}
.icon-1-09:before {
  content: "\e908";
}
.icon-1-10:before {
  content: "\e909";
}
.icon-1-11:before {
  content: "\e90a";
}
.icon-1-12:before {
  content: "\e90b";
}
.icon-1-13:before {
  content: "\e90c";
}
.icon-1-14:before {
  content: "\e90d";
}
.icon-1-15:before {
  content: "\e90e";
}
.icon-1-16:before {
  content: "\e90f";
}




 

.noscroll{ height:100vh; overflow:hidden}
.max-box{ max-width: 640px;margin: 0 auto;overflow:hidden}

.head-bj{ width: 100% ; height: .5rem ; padding: .02rem 0; background-color: #eee ; position: fixed; left: 0; top: 0; z-index: 9; }
.head-box{ width: 94% ; margin:  0 auto; position: relative;}
.head-box img{ width: 1.233rem ; height: .385rem ; float: left; margin: .055rem 0 0 .05rem}
.head-box .icon{font-size: .24rem;color: #28577f;right: 0;position: absolute;margin: .13rem .05rem 0 0;}




/* 栏目 */
.lm-bj{ width: 100% ; height: 100% ; background: rgba(0, 0, 0, 0.3) ; position: fixed; left: 0; top: 0; z-index: 10;display: none}

.gb{ width: .22rem; margin-left: 80%; margin-top: .26rem; margin-bottom: .12rem}
.list{width:72%; height: 100%; background-color: #f0f0f0 ; position: fixed; right: -72%; top: 0 ;  z-index: 99; }
.list ul{ width: 100% ; height: 100% ; overflow-y: auto;}
.list ul li{ width: 100% ; border-bottom: 1px solid #cacace;}
.list ul li a{color: #9a9a9a; font-size:.16rem; display: block;  height:.44rem;line-height: .44rem;position: relative; background: url(../images/da1.png) no-repeat .2rem center; background-size: .08rem ;text-indent: .35rem}
.list ul li .inactives a{ font-weight: bold}
.list ul li ul li a{ font-size: .15rem; background: url(../images/zuo.png) no-repeat .3rem center; background-size: .09rem auto ;text-indent: .45rem}
.list ul li .cor{background: url(../images/da2.png) no-repeat .2rem center; background-size: .08rem ;text-indent: .35rem;color: #28577f ;} 
.list ul li ul{display: none; width: 100% ; background-color: #f8f8f8;}
.list ul li ul li:last-child{border: none}


.copy-bj{ width: 100% ; background-color: #eee ; padding: .12rem 0}
.copy-box{ width: 88% ; margin: 0 auto; text-align: center;}
.copy-box h3{ font-size: .1rem; color: #9a9a9a}
.copy-box h3 a{ font-size: .1rem; color: #9a9a9a}

@media screen and (min-width: 620px) {

	
}
@media screen and (width: 360px) {

	
}




